I have the Jitsi-Meet package installed from the official repo. The default install works great with no tweaking.

However, when I modify the nginx file for my Jitsi-Meet page to listen on the VPN interface, I am able to connect to the VPN, browse to my Jitsi-Meet page, enter a chat name, proceed to the chat (where I'm asked to share my mic/cam) then nothing happens. I'm stuck on the blue page shown in the attached screenshot.

Switching the nginx file back to listening on all interfaces fixes the issue to where the service works as expected but is accessible from the internet which is not the desired configuration.

My camera light is on and Firefox thinks it is sharing the mic and cam with something.
